Abstracts

English Abstract


The present invention relates to the automatic construction of buildings or
other heavy constructions by a method and a device suitable for reducing the
construction time and for assisting its relative operations. This method
comprises the steps of CAD- modelling a structure through volume or surface
modelling steps, sectioning the structure computed model with horizontal
parallel planes according to a predetermined pitch, prearranging an apparatus
that deposits in alternation a layer of granular material and a liquid binder
only in coincidence with the solid portions of said plane, within containing
walls that define a closed perimeter. This method can be carried out by an
apparatus having a horizontal frame (1) suitable for supporting a bridge crane
(15) capable of causing and operating head to move (16) in a horizontal plane
defined by said horizontal frame (1) . The frame (1) is movable along four
uprights (3, 4, 5, 6) vertically (11,12,13,14), the bridge crane (15) is
sliding horizontally (18) , and the operating head is sliding horizontally
(19) .

Field of the invention
The present invention relates to building and, in
particular to the automatic construction of buildings or
other heavy constructions by a method and a device suitable
for reducing the building time and for assisting its
relative operations. The present invention is used also to
build particularly articulated and complex structures.
Background of the invention
Many methods are known for making buildings, with
different construction techniques and materials.
A well known technique uses concrete that is cast in
a semi-fluid form in a formwork. With this technique
volumes of concrete are obtained having the shape of the
formwork used.
This technique has the drawback a complex work is
required to obtain complex forms having convexities and
concavities, mainly owing to the difficulty to provide
formworks with shape complex and owing to the low
resistance to pulling stresses of the concrete, which
requires the use of steel reinforcements that must be
folded to follow the shape of the formwork.
Another drawback is the cost of the manual work to
make the formwork before casting the concrete and for
removing the formworks after hardening.
A further drawback is the cost of the formwork
material.
Another drawback of the method for construction with
concrete is the waiting time necessary for hardening.
It is felt, then, the need of a method for making
buildings, which is quick and not expensive, suitable for

CA 02602071 2007-09-21
WO 2006/100556 PCT/IB2006/000596
- 2 -
being carried out with an automatic method

Description of the preferred exemplary embodiment
In the following description an example will be shown
of an embodiment of an apparatus that carries out the
method according to the invention.
In particular, in figure 1 an apparatus is described
according to the invention suitable for making
automatically conglomerate structures of buildings. it
comprises a framework having four uprights 3, 4, 5, 6
capable of supporting a horizontal frame 1 movable
vertically along such uprights.
Horizontal frame 1, with closed shape has at least
two parallel sides 2 for slidingly engaging with two ends
of a bridge crane 15 which holds an operating head 16.
Altogether, operating head 16 moves along arrow 19
perpendicular to the sliding direction 18 of bridge crane
15 and frame 1 can move vertically along arrows 11, 12,
13, 14.
In figure 2 an end portion of bridge crane 15 is
shown more in detail. The bridge crane structure 15
comprises a beam 21, having at each end a couple of wheels
23 that engage with the inner part of the beams 2 of
figure 1. A guide 20 is provided integral and parallel to
beam 21 that slidingly holds a slide 24 of operating head
16, which is capable of spraying a liquid binder on a just
deposited layer of granular material. Beam 21 supports a
hopper 17 with elongated shape, which extends along the
length of beam 21 and is adapted to deposit a
predetermined amount of granular material at one end of
the depositing plane. Along beam 21 a blade is arranged

CA 02602071 2007-09-21
WO 2006/100556 PCT/IB2006/000596
for spreading the granular material just deposited by the
above described hopper 17.
Figures 3 and 4 show respectively a perspective view
and a front view of an apparatus according to the
invention and figure 5 is a view of operating head 16,
relative to a first operative deposition step of an amount
of granular material, in which frame 1 is at the position
of zero (ground level), bridge crane 15 is in its first
stop position and operating head 16 is in its first stop
position.
The apparatus comprises four containing walls 31
that define a volume that is going to be filled with
granular material following the method according to the
invention.
Figures 6, 7 and 8 show the apparatus according to
the invention, during a step of spreading the granular
material along the exposed surface of the previously
deposited layer. In this step bridge crane 15 moves
towards its second limit stop, distributing and leveling
the granular material deposited in the previous step, by
blade 22.
Figures 9, 10 and 11 show the apparatus at the end
of the previous step. Frame 1 is still at ground level,
bridge crane 15 has achieved its second limit stop and is
still, while operating head 16 is still at its first limit
stop.
Figures 12, 13 and 14 show the apparatus in a step
of back stroke when operating head 16 sprays the binder on
the layer of granular material only at the solid areas of
the calculated cross section. In this step frame 1 is
still at the zero level, bridge crane 15 moves back and
operating head 16 sprays the binder and moves along its
sliding axis.
Figures 15, 16 and 17 show the apparatus at the end

CA 02602071 2007-09-21
WO 2006/100556 PCT/IB2006/000596
- 9 -
of the spraying step, when frame 1 is still at ground
level, bridge crane 15 and operating head 16 have moved
back to their first limit stop. In this position, the
doser 40 of bridge crane 15 is filled with an amount of
granular material to be deposited in the next step.
Figures 18, 19 and 20 show the repetition of the
previous steps, in particular of the first step, on a
second distribution level reached by raising frame 1 for a
height equal to the pitch. In this step the amount of
granular material stored in the previous step is deposited
by doser 40. When frame 1 is stepped up, bridge crane 15
and operating head 16 are at the respective first limit
stops.
In figure 21 the apparatus is carrying out its last
step before completion of the conglomerate structure.
In figure 22 the structure of building 50 has been
completed. The next steps are the evacuation of the
granular material not cemented by the binder, thus leaving
the cemented part and then the structure, and removing the
containing walls and then the apparatus.
Figure 23 shows a cross sectional view of a portion
of structure comprising two layers of granular material 61
and 62 deposited in two successive steps. The resin is
selected from the group comprised of epoxy resin and cross
linking polyurethane; it has a viscosity set between 3 and
10 poises, and preferably between 6 and 8 poises, and is
adapted to be fluid enough to penetrate between the
granules of the granular material for a hei.ght
corresponding to pitch 68, thus achieving the layer 64 of
granular material previously formed.
In particular, said granular material has a
granulometry set between 0,1 and 2 mm, and preferably
between 0,5 and 1,5 mm; this way the granular material has
a maximum effective porosity adapted to cause said binder

CA 02602071 2007-09-21
WO 2006/100556 PCT/IB2006/000596
- 10 -
to penetrate between the deposited granules up to reaching
the layer already sprayed in the previous cycle.
